  • © Licensed to London News Pictures. 19/10/2017. London, UK. Queen Elizabeth II reviews The King's Troop Royal Horse<br />
Artillery in Hyde Park, on the occasion of their 70th Anniversary. The KTRHA was formed on the wishes of His Majesty King George VI in October 1947. Commonly known as the ‘Gunners’, The Royal Artillery provides firepower to the British Army. Equipped with 13-pounder field guns dating from WWI, the Troop provides ceremonial salutes for Royal occasions and state functions. Photo credit: Ray Tang/LNP

  • © Licensed to London News Pictures. 13/06/2013. London, UK. Her Majesty the Queen is seen at the Household Division's annual Beating Retreat parade at Horse Guards Parade in London. On two successive evenings each year in June a pageant of military music, precision marching and colour takes place on Horse Guards Parade in the heart of London when the Massed Bands of the Household Division carry out the Ceremony of Beating Retreat. 300 musicians, drummers and pipers perform this age-old ceremony. The Retreat has origins in the early days of chivalry when beating or sounding retreat pulled a halt to the days fighting. Photo credit: Matt Cetti-Roberts/LNP
